Airbnb and Short-Term Rental Properties as DSCR Investment Properties in Hartford
Short-term rental properties qualify for DSCR loans with specialized STR programs. These programs use projected Airbnb/VRBO income (often from AirDNA data) instead of long-term rental comps to calculate the DSCR ratio.
STR DSCR programs can dramatically improve your DSCR ratio by using short-term rental income projections instead of long-term rent comps. Ideal for vacation and tourist markets.
Short-Term Rental Income in Hartford
While Hartford may have limited short-term rental regulations or lower tourist demand compared to major vacation markets, STR DSCR programs can still be used if the projected income supports the loan. The estimated $1,950/mo above uses a conservative 1.5x multiplier on long-term rent.
STR DSCR lenders typically use AirDNA or similar platforms to project short-term rental income for the specific property address. This projection replaces the standard rent appraisal used in traditional DSCR underwriting, often resulting in a higher qualifying rent and better DSCR ratio.
